[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

[Debian]:Re: wdm



Ingo Saitz <Ingo.Saitz@stud.uni-hannover.de> writes:

> > wdm startet. Fuer xdm gibt es einen zwei Jahre alten bugreport (mit
> > angehefteten patch), wo darum gebeten wird, das xdm auch
> > /etc/environment einliest. Weiss vielleicht jemand (der die
> > developer-Liste liesst), warum das noch nicht eingeflossen ist?
> 
> AFAIK gibt es keinen Konsens darüber, wer die Datei
> /etc/environment einlesen soll noch welches Format die Einträge
> enthalten sollen. Wenn wirklich _alle_ Login-Umgebungen diese
> Datei einlesen sollten, müßte sie für einige Shells (csh
> basierende z.B.) geparst werden. Ein Vorschlag war sogar, diese
> Datei ganz abzuschaffen...

Ja, /etc/environment ist chronisch unbrauchbar, solange da nicht
endlich eine grundlegende Regelung gefunden wird.
Sprich: Es ist kaputt und man benutzt es nicht, weil man sich
sonst früher oder später höchst unelegant in den Fuß schießt.

Aber zurück zum Ursprungsproblem: Wo ist da überhaupt das Problem?

Wenn man denn unter einem unter xdm/wdm/usw. gestarteten X das gleiche
Environment haben will, wie unter einem von der Konsole gestarteten,
dann baut man das Environment eben systemweit mittels
/etc/X11/Xsession oder (prefered) bei Bedarf in ~/.xsession
entsprechend auf, indem man dort beispielsweise /etc/profile,
~/.profile oder ~/.bash_profile sourced oder anderweitig geeignete
Einträge macht. Genau dafür ist es u.a. gedacht.

Das ist der übliche Weg und IMHO erheblich sinnvoller, als allen Usern
zwangsweise etwas per xdm zu verbacken. Ganz abgesehen davon, daß es
durchaus Sinn machen kann, für X und Konsole auch environmentmäßig
getrennt Wege zu gehen und andere Setups zu fahren.

cu,

marcus

-- 
      ...and that is how we know the Earth to be banana-shaped.
eMail: bofh@bogomips.de
------------------------------------------------
Um sich aus der Liste auszutragen schicken Sie
bitte eine E-Mail an majordomo@jfl.de die im Body
"unsubscribe debian-user-de <deine emailadresse>"
enthaelt.
Bei Problemen bitte eine Mail an: Jan.Otto@jfl.de
------------------------------------------------
Anzahl der eingetragenen Mitglieder:     730


Reply to: